The Fairy Faith
Fairies have appeared in many cultures, including that of the ancient Celts, and Shakespeare utilized them in his plays. Hollywood has its famous fairies, notably Tinkerbell of Peter Pan, the Fairy Godmother of Cinderella, and the Blue Fairy from Pinocchio. The Fairy Faith looks beyond Hollywood to the more complex fairies of other countries, surveying the origins of the enduring belief in the creatures. John Walker, director of the video, also investigates the manner in which fairies are depicted in art and literature, and talks with some individuals who say they can see into the world of fairies. ~ Alice Day, All Movie Guide
